Changes to Paid Parental Leave

From 1 July 2023

• Parental Leave Pay and Dad and Partner Pay will be combined into a single 20 week payment.
• Introduction of gender-neutral claiming to allow either parent to claim
• Parents able to take weeks of Parental Leave Pay at the same time
• Introduction of a family income limit of $350,000 adjusted taxable income in addition to the existing individual income limit of $156,647.
• PPL will be able to taken in blocks as small as one day between periods of paid work, within two years from the date of birth or adoption
• There will be a “use it or lose it” portion to encourage both parents to access PPL

Starting from 1 July 2024, Parental Leave Pay will increase by 2 weeks each year until 1 July 2026 when it will reach 26 weeks.
